El Invisible (English Translation) Lyrics Meaning
[Intro: Cuti Carabajal & Roberto Carabajal]
A playful, musical opening to set the mood.
[Verse 1: Cuti Carabajal]
The singer talks about living in poverty in a collapsing house by the river with people like him. He never went to school and can’t read or write, yet politicians still fight over his vote as if it matters.
[Verse 2: Cuti Carabajal & Roberto Carabajal]
At night, he goes out with his children to search through trash to survive. He dreams of things he’s not allowed to have and feels invisible, like he doesn’t exist in society or anyone notices him.
[Bridge]
A teacher enters the scene.
[Verse 3: Milo j]
He notices how the rich get everything just because of their family name. When he tries to enjoy a simple pleasure, like drinking wine, he feels anger and frustration, struggling to hold back his emotions.
[Bridge]
Polite recognition of someone singing beautifully.
[Verse 4: Cuti Carabajal]
He refuses to join political parties or accept charity. He wants dignity and dreams of a better life, but society ignores him, making him feel invisible and erased from the world.
[Outro: Cuti Carabajal & Milo j]
The song ends with repeated musical sounds and a call to keep moving forward despite hardship. It encourages leaving marks, making noise, and refusing to disappear quietly, insisting on being noticed and remembered.
